Record fair in Mullingar this weekend

image preview

Record Fairs Ireland are back in the Midlands, and are making a return to Mullingar at Danny Byrnes this Saturday July 17. The fair will feature a massive head-spinning range of vinyl records spanning almost every era and every genre - from the 1950s right up to the present day - from blues to metal, rap to alternative, punk to funk, post-rock to 80s rock and Irish to indie.

Oxigen breathes life into Westmeath jobs market

Oxigen, the company which won the Westmeath County Council tender for handling domestic waste in the county, has created seven new full time jobs since the start of the year bringing total staff in the county to 12.

Tánaiste to be guest speaker at Mullingar Chamber Awards 2010

Mullingar Chamber of Commerce have announced Tánaiste Mary Coughlan as guest speaker for this year’s Mullingar Chamber business dinner and awards which will take place on Thursday April 15 in the Mullingar Park Hotel. As the premiere business event in the Midlands the Mullingar Chamber Awards highlight the business owners, organisations, and individuals who have developed successful business and industry in Mullingar and also those that have given back to the local community.
